#5522c0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5522c0 is composed of 33.3% red, 13.3%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.7% cyan, 82.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 259.4 degrees, a saturation of 69.9% and a lightness of 44.3%. #5522c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#aa44ff with #000081.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

Shades and Tints of #5522c0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040209 is the darkest color, while #f9f7fe is the lightest one.
